Japanese storytelling today draws heavily from Shinto and Buddhist philosophies. Shintoism, with its belief that spirits ( kami ) inhabit all things, directly inspires the environmental themes and magical realism seen in Studio Ghibli films like Spirited Away . The industry culture, however, is a cautionary tale. Animators are notoriously overworked and underpaid, surviving on ramen and passion. Yet, the output is staggering. The culture of shokunin (artisan craftsmanship) means that even a background character drinking coffee in a slice-of-life anime has a meticulously drawn label on the coffee can. Japanese variety shows are a cultural artifact. They prioritize . It isn’t enough to eat a strange food; the camera must capture the exact millisecond your face turns red. This "documentary style" of comedy has influenced global YouTube culture immensely (think of "reaction videos"), but Japan has been perfecting it since the 1980s.
